Where can I find
parks/playgrounds for children?
There is a lovely garden adjacent to the
Atheneum on India Street, as well as
a number of “pocket parks” scattered
throughout Town. Children’s Beach,
Jetties Beach, Lily Pond, Nantucket
Elementary School, Tom Nevers Field
and the Nantucket Airport all feature
playgrounds for children. The Skateboard
Park on Backus Lane (off Surfside Road) is
a very popular spot for teens and ‘tweens.
The Elementary School playground also
features a soccer pitch. Tuppancy Links,
Sanford Farm, and the cranberry bogs off
Milestone Road are also terrific spots for
long, leisurely walks. Exploration Station
is a play center at 135 Old South Road
featuring a science-themed dream space
for children 2.9-8 years old. Inspired by
children’s museums, Exploration Station
is filled with exciting and interesting
activities and art stations.
What does ACK mean?
ACK is the Federal Aviation Administration’s official three-letter code for
Nantucket Memorial Airport, taken from
letters in the word Nantucket. The US
government uses “N” for military airport
installations. Thus, Nantucket and Washington’s National Airport use ACK and
DCA rather than NAN and NAT. ACK has
become “shorthand” or slang when
referring to Nantucket.
Do I need a car on Nantucket?
It is not necessary to bring a car to
Nantucket. Bicycles are popular means
of transportation, and there are paved
bike paths leading to all ends of the
island. Rental vehicles and taxis are also
available, and the Nantucket Regional
Transit Authority provides island-wide
seasonal shuttle service. Traffic congestion
is a growing concern among visitors and
residents alike. Fewer cars on Nantucket’s
streets and roads will mean a more
tranquil vacation experience for everyone!
